a+b+c=180,  \text{ }c+e=180 \implies \\ a+b+c=c+e \implies \\ a+b=e\\

This result is actually true for any exterior angle. The exterior angle of a triangle is equal to the sum of the two remote angles, and above is a short proof of it.

How to get X or y alone
Trava [24]
To get X and Y by itself, move everything else to the other side of the equal sign. Do this by doing the opposite operation.

Example: x-2y=11 
             add 2y to both sides to get x by itself 
           x=2y+11
